3.1.4.
1 сұрақ Айнымалы дегеніміз не? Айнымалы атауды таңдағанда қандай ережелерді сақтау керек?
Жауап: Бағдарламалаудағы айнымалы мән - бұл иә сақтауға болатын жадтың аталған аймағыдық. Айнымалы атауды таңдау ережелері:
Айнымалының аты _ әрпінен немесе астын сызудан басталуы керек.
Айнымалы атауында әріптер, сандар және астын сызу _ болуы мүмкін.
Айнымалының атауы регистрді ескереді (яғни myVar және myVar әр түрлі айнымалылар).
Резервтелген Python сөздерін (кілт сөздерді) айнымалы атаулар ретінде пайдалану ұсынылмайды.
2. Бағдарламалаудағы сызықтық алгоритм дегеніміз не?
Бағдарламалаудағы сызықтық алгоритм шартты операторларсыз (if-else) немесе циклдарсыз (for, while) ретімен орындалатын әрекеттер тізбегі болып табылады.. Алгоритмнің бұл түрі сызықтық орындалу барысымен сипатталады, мұнда әрбір пәрмен алдыңғысынан кейін дәл бір рет орындалады.
3. Сандармен жұмыс істеу үшін сызықтық алгоритмдерде қандай амалдар бар? Арифметикалық амалдарға мысалдар келтіріңіз.
Сызықтық алгоритмдерде негізгі арифметикалық амалдар қолжетімді:
Қосу (+): a + b
Азайту (-): a - b
Көбейту (*): a * b
Бөлу (/): а / б
Бүтін санды бөлу (//): a // b
Дәрежеге көтеру (**): a ** b
Бөлінуден қалған қалдық (%): a % b
4. Сызықтық алгоритмдерде мәліметтердің қандай түрлерін қолдануға болады? Мысалдар келтіріңіз.
Сызықтық алгоритмдерде деректердің әртүрлі түрлері пайдаланылуы мүмкін, соның ішінде:
Бүтін сандар (int): мысалы, 5, 10, -3.
Қалқымалы нүкте сандары (float): мысалы, 3.14, -0.5.
Жолдар (str): мысалы, "Сәлем", "Python".
Логикалық мәндер (bool): Шын немесе жалған.
Тізімдер (тізім), кортеждер (кортеж), жиындар (жиын) және сөздіктер (дикт) сияқты деректер жинақтары.
5. Сызықтық алгоритмді құрайтын негізгі элементтер қандай?
Сызықтық алгоритмнің негізгі элементтеріне мыналар жатады:
Деректерді енгізу.
Операциялардың немесе есептеулердің реттілігін орындау.
Нәтижелерді шығару.
6. Сызықтық алгоритмнің дұрыс жұмыс істеуін тексеру үшін қандай әдістерді қолдануға болады?
Сызықтық алгоритмнің дұрыс жұмыс істеуін тексеру үшін келесі әдістерді қолдануға болады:
Достарыңызбен бөлісу: |